What Is Geometry Dash Lite?

Geometry Dash Lite is a rhythm-based platformer developed by RobTop Games, released in 2013 for iOS, Android, and web browsers. It is a stripped-down, ad-supported version of the full Geometry Dash ($1.99), offering 19 challenging levels, customizable icons, and addictive one-touch gameplay.

To survive each level, you must tap precisely as your cube, ship, ball, UFO, wave, robot, or spider moves through portals, spikes, sawblades, and moving platforms—all timed to the beat.

Gameplay Mechanics and Controls

The core challenge is simple: move through auto-scrolling levels without crashing. Here is how it works:

  • Mobile: tap to jump, hold to fly (ship/UFO), swipe for some mechanics
  • PC: spacebar or left-click to jump; Z/X for Practice Mode checkpoints
  • Icon forms: cube, ship, ball, UFO, wave, robot, and spider—each with unique movement
  • Portals change your size, shape, speed, or gravity instantly
  • Pro tip: wear headphones—the music often cues upcoming obstacles

Practice Mode is essential for demon levels. Drop checkpoints and repeat tough segments until muscle memory takes over.

Each level has three secret coins, often in risky spots. Beat the level first, then collect coins once you are comfortable.

Tips and Tricks

  1. Use Practice Mode—drop checkpoints and repeat hard sections until they click.
  2. Listen to the music; the beat often tells you when to jump or hit a portal.
  3. Use bright icon colors so you can see your character in busy backgrounds.
  4. Break levels into chunks (0–20%, 20–40%) and master each before moving on.
  5. Take breaks when frustrated—coming back fresh helps more than raging.
  6. Watch walkthroughs on YouTube for demon-level patterns.
  7. Skip coins on your first clear—they usually require risky detours.
